Immerse yourself in the timeless genius of Johann Sebastian Bach with "Bach: L'œuvre pour orgue," a captivating collection of his most renowned organ works. Released in 1962 under the BNF Collection label, this album is a testament to Bach's unparalleled mastery of the classical genre, specifically within the realm of classical piano and organ compositions.
Spanning a concise yet impactful 43 minutes, the album features a series of preludes, fugues, fantasias, and toccatas that showcase Bach's intricate and harmonically rich style. The tracklist includes iconic pieces such as the Prelude and Fugue in D Major, BWV 532, the Fantasia and Fugue in C Minor, BWV 537, and the Toccata and Fugue in E Major, BWV 566, among others.
